Baby Jesus on pedestal. Polychrome wood. Mechelen, 16th century, with restorations. Carved and polychrome wooden Child Jesus standing on a pedestal of the same material, standing, advancing, with his right hand blessing and an orb in his left. Stylistically, it corresponds to the shape, size, iconography, etc. common among those known as “Malines Dolls” or “Children Jesus of Mechelen”, polychrome wooden figures designed to be dressed and decorated that were made in Mechelen (Belgium) in significant numbers and were exported throughout Europe between the mid-15th century and first half of the 16th century. Compare the present example with the 16th century Child from the Hof van Busleyden Museum (Mechelen, Belgium), the one dated around 1500 kept in the Louvre Museum (Paris), the one from around 1500 from the Museum of Fairs Foundation, etc. .
